Chili for my Dad, with Pablano Peppers

skunkmonkey101
skunkmonkey101 @skunk_monkey101
Dover, Florida

This chili I used pablano peppers in it. I usually like hatch, jalapeno, or cayenne peppers in it. This chili I made for my Dad, he is not doing so good these days. He cannot eat spicy food and he love beans in his chili. He ate a whole bowl full of this recipe with some cornbread!!!! 😁 Happy Days!!!

Ingredients

  • 3-1/2 poundsground chuck
  • 1 poundpork bulk sausage (the one in the tube)
  • 4 cupsdiced pablano peppers (2 large whole peppers)
  • 3 cupsdiced onion 1/2 cup of this reserved (topping)
  • 15 ouncesred beans
  • 15 ouncesdark red kidney beans
  • 15 ounceslight red kidney beans
  • 15 ouncespinto beans
  • 30 ouncestomato sauce
  • 8 ouncestomato paste
  • 30 ouncesdiced tomatoes
  • 1 tablespoonground cumin
  • 1/4 cupdried cilantro
  • 2 teaspoonsgranulated garlic powder
  • 2 teaspoonssalt
  • 1/3 cupbalsamic vinegar
  • 1/3 cuphoney
  • 8 ounceshot water
  • 1 teaspoonground black water

Steps

  1. 1

    Dice the onions.

  2. 2

    Dice the pablano peppers. Mix with the onion and get to room temperature. I refrigerate the onions and peppers, it makes them easier to dice.

  3. 3

    Start browning the chuck and sausage. Add the spices and herbs. Add in the balsamic vinegar. Break the meat up and add the peppers and onions.

  4. 4

    Cover and the juices of the onion and pepper will release. Do this for about 15 minutes.

  5. 5

    Drain the beans and add to the pot. If you don't want beans omit them. Add the diced tomatoes, and tomato sauce. Mix the tomato paste with the hot water and add. Stir in the honey. Taste and adjust the flavor.

  6. 6

    Serve with the reserved onion on top. Feel free to add shredded cheese, nacho cheese, sour cream, serve on top of hamburger, hotdog, or sausage sandwiches. I hope you enjoy!!!
